Benefits of Seated Dumbbell Military Press

The seated dumbbell military press offers several benefits that make it a popular choice for individuals wanting to develop their shoulder strength and overall upper body stability. Some of the key advantages of incorporating this exercise into your routine include:

  1. Shoulder Development: The primary target of the seated dumbbell military press is the deltoid muscle, which is responsible for the roundness and width of your shoulders. This exercise stimulates both the anterior (front), medial (middle), and posterior (rear) deltoid heads, promoting balanced shoulder development.

  2. Increased Upper Body Strength: The seated dumbbell military press engages multiple muscle groups, including the trapezius, triceps, and upper chest muscles. Over time, this exercise can help improve total upper body strength and enhance functional movement patterns.

  3. Improved Core Stability: To maintain proper form during the seated dumbbell military press, you must engage your core muscles. Regularly performing this exercise can help strengthen your core and improve overall stability, reducing the risk of injuries and enhancing overall athleticism.

  4. Enhanced Shoulder Stabilization: As a compound exercise, the seated dumbbell military press requires stabilizer muscles to work in conjunction with the main muscles. By engaging these stabilizers throughout the movement, you can improve joint stability and reduce the risk of shoulder injuries.

  5. Versatility: Seated dumbbell military presses can be modified to meet different fitness levels. By adjusting the weight, volume, or tempo, beginners and advanced trainees alike can tailor this exercise to their specific needs.

Proper Technique for Seated Dumbbell Military Press

To reap the full benefits of the seated dumbbell military press and minimize the risk of injury, it is crucial to follow the correct technique. Here's a step-by-step breakdown of how to perform the exercise:

  1. Setup: Sit on a sturdy bench with your feet firmly planted on the floor and a dumbbell in each hand. Begin with the weights resting on your shoulders, palms facing forward, elbows bent at 90 degrees, and your back straight.

  2. Engage Your Core: Before initiating the movement, engage your core muscles by contracting your abdominals. This will provide a stable base for the exercise.

  3. Pressing Motion: Exhale as you press the dumbbells overhead, extending your elbows fully without locking them. Be sure to push through your shoulder blades and maintain a neutral spine throughout the movement.

  4. Lowering Phase: Inhale as you slowly lower the dumbbells back to the starting position, maintaining control and focusing on the eccentric contraction. Keep your core engaged and avoid allowing the weights to rest on your shoulders.

  5. Repeat: Perform the desired number of repetitions, maintaining proper form and focusing on engaging the shoulder muscles throughout the exercise.

Tips for Effective Execution

To maximize the effectiveness of the seated dumbbell military press, consider the following tips:

  1. Start with Lighter Weights: If you're new to this exercise, begin with lighter dumbbells to familiarize yourself with the movement pattern and gradually increase the weight as you build strength and confidence.

  2. Maintain Proper Form: Focus on maintaining a neutral spine, avoiding excessive arching of the back or leaning too far forward. Keep your shoulders down and back, engage your core, and utilize a controlled tempo throughout the exercise.

  3. Controlled Tempo: Emphasize the eccentric (lowering) phase of the movement by lowering the dumbbells slowly and under control. This will further stimulate muscle growth and improve shoulder stability.

  4. Progressive Overload: To continue making progress, gradually increase the weight or resistance used over time. This will challenge your muscles and promote ongoing gains in strength and size.

  5. Listen to Your Body: If you experience any pain or discomfort while performing the seated dumbbell military press, stop immediately and consult with a qualified fitness professional. It's essential to prioritize your safety and well-being during any exercise routine.
